The Senior Software Engineer works closely with Product and Engineering teams to solve complex and impactful problems by shipping high-quality features, enhancements, and maintenance packages to the Absencesoft core platform. Software engineers work in an agile process and drive changes from refinement through delivery for both microservices and monolithic components. Software Engineers participate in a DevOps model building functionality, tests, deployment, and monitoring aspects of every story.


Who We Are
AbsenceSoft is a rapidly growing Leave Management software company looking to hire amazing people like you! We are a radically innovative provider of SaaS solutions for FMLA, Disability, ADA, and other types of absences. We pride ourselves in having created the most easily used, installed, and understood absence management system and Human Resources Software. We value creative, innovative people who are passionate about their work and who always believe there is always a better way.

 

Leading With Our Core Values (THRIVE)

  • Team - We are a team. We show up for each other, act with empathy, listen well, have fun, collaborate, and bring our authentic selves to work every day.
  • Honesty - We are honest, trustworthy, and transparent with each other and our clients. We act with integrity, ask the tough questions, and are open to honest feedback.
  • Results - We are results-driven and act with urgency, accountability, and commitment. We strive for continuous improvement and operational efficiency.
  • Inspiring - We inspire and challenge each other every day. We bring a positive, can-do attitude to the team and lift everyone up around us.
  • Value - We provide tremendous value to our customers, employees, and shareholders, which drives everything we do and guides our decision making.
  • Entrepreneurial - We are willing to try new things and take risks, without fear of failure. We continuously learn and improve in a fast-paced environment.

 

What You’ll Do

  • Design and develop high-quality API based features in serverless, containerized, and EC2-based applications
  • Participate in a high-velocity software development lifecycle, ensuring architectural, compliance, and quality goals are achieved
  • Develop and maintain messaging, workflow, and business logic domains
  • Develop automated tests to prove the soundness of your code
  • Collaborate with peers via code reviews, design sessions, testing, and agile ceremonies
  • Monitor infrastructure and identify issues in all environments
  • Actively participate in a distributed team; ensure alignment and collaboration in a distributed work-from-home model

What’ll Set You Up for Success

  • Bachelor’s degree in Computer Science, a similar discipline, or commensurate experience
  • 5+ Years delivering commercial software applications in a SaaS environment
  • 4+ years Experience with C# / .Net 4.8 and/or .Net 6.0
  • Experience designing and building REST-based API Architectures
  • Experience with relational and NoSQL databases: MongoDB, and PostgreSQL preferred
  • Entrepreneurial in thinking, outlook, and creative problem-solving
  • Prior experience in a technical leadership role
  • Strong work ethic and ability to multitask on parallel projects and efforts
  • Strong verbal and written communication skills


Nice to Have 

  • Experience developing and maintaining CI/CD Pipelines in tools like Jenkins and GIT
  • Experience developing HTML/Javascript based user interfaces in tools like React and Vue
  • Experience working with Javascript and related technologies
  • Experience working with AWS based cloud technologies, including AWS Lambda and related services


What To Know Before You Apply

  • We’re located in beautiful Golden, Colorado. 
  • This is a full-time, salaried position + bonus.
  • AbsenceSoft provides a wide variety of perks and benefits. Including full medical, dental, vision, 401K, and life insurance. We support your professional growth including industry training and CLMS Certification; opportunities for additional industry and technology certifications, and continuing education.
  • The salary range for this position is between $130,000 - $150,000.


At AbsenceSoft, we are committed to building a team that represents a variety of diverse backgrounds, perspectives, and skills. We are proud to be an equal opportunity workplace that celebrates and supports diversity and inclusion. We make all employment and related decisions without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, veteran status, disability status, age, or any other status protected by law.

This position has been filled.